D7000v2 Cannot login to router

Hi There,

I have just upgraded to FTTC (UK) and bought a D7000v2 to replace the Plusnet free router.  The Genie Login for the Netgear router will wokr briefly after a reboot, but within less than 5 minutes it freezes until the router is rebooted again.  It seems to be holding a WAN connection just fine and the WiFi seems fine, but I am frustrated that the Genie is so intermittent.  I have updated the firmware today.  I have installed the iPhone app, but really this doesn't have the level of detail that I want to manage my router.  The iPhone "Nighthawk" app said it wasn't compatible with this router.  I thought it was a "Nighthawk" because it says it on the box, but I may be wrong.

 

Any ideas about this issue?  Is it potentially a dud router?

Re: D7000v2 Cannot login to router

@Fazzam 

 

Greetings.

Based on your description, I would recommend the following.

 

-All configuration, management and updating should be done from a PC connected to the router directly via ethernet.

-Do not use your phone, Genie, NightHawk App or any other method to setup or manage.  Web interface only.

-Start over, reset the device using the reset button on the back.  I use a toothpick with the tip broken off (works great)

-Perform set up again from scratch

 

What you should try:

After you reset the device, connect to it from a wired PC as I mentioned.  STOP here.  Wait. What happens next.  If the interface remains accessible, continue with set up and configuration.

 

If it freezes again, you may need to re-flash it's firmware.  Here's why.  You said you had upgraded the FW.  Some methods are more reliable than others.  A bad or incomplete flash can leave the router in a semi-functioning unstable state.  Behavior such as freezing after a short period of time might indicate this.

 

We aren't there to see what's happening, what you did or how you did it.  The steps above will help you determine what to do next.

Re: D7000v2 Cannot login to router

Thanks for taking the time to reply.  I think perhaps there were two issues.

 

Firstly I was connecting wirelessly, my previous TP-Link Router never took issue with this.

Secondly I was trying to get Readyshare to work with an external HDD which is a Seagate 2TB drive which from memory is a few years old.  I've since plugged the HDD in to my PC and it has found drive errors.  A spare Toshiba SSD seems to working fine with the Router, so perhaps the old Seagate is to blame.

 

So at the moment it is working fine, but I will save your post for future reference just in case.
